Output 16d40b1cc12faffbfeb9c301d8da613ad592c06ae4a005bb26afc73b518c91ef:1

value
467804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67a9391cbcdb730107f32f7486fd0034c659a1a1 OP_EQUAL
address
3B98F8SLiY1Xuiownicxmti1bP5W5Lw7sb
transaction
16d40b1cc12faffbfeb9c301d8da613ad592c06ae4a005bb26afc73b518c91ef
confirmations
103649
spent
true